As postdoc at the Department of Forensic Medicine, I work primarily with chemical trace analysis; especially with advanced mass spectrometry imaging of fingerprints. I have a Ph.D. from 2006 and am educated chemist with a minor in mathematics from Aarhus University in 2002. I have previously worked with molecular imaging within nuclear medicine at Aarhus University Hospital.
My primary work is development of new methods for chemical trace analysis with a special focus on fingerprints; a work that is carried out in close collaboration with the Danish police. The goal of the new methods is to make even more traces collected at crime scenes useful in police investigations. I also contribute to other tasks of the department within synthetic and analytical chemistry.
